Paresthesia In Feet, Get Shooting Pains On Rubbing The Bottom Of Feet, Numbness On Tailbone And Buttocks, Tests Showed High Cortisol. Cure?

I developed parathesia in december 2011 in both of my feet and its getting worse, the numbness and coldness has always been there but now its getting worse with pins and needles and feeling like I have my feet bound in really tight shoes, and get shooting pain and when the rub the bottom of my feet they hurt. Lately my tailbone and buttocks feel numb when I sit down. What is going on, I had a blood work up everything good except my cortisol was 23.34 is it really that high? I have an appointment to see a neurologist in 6 weeks. I m on prozac , clonazapam for depression and neurotin for my feet but they are getting worse, what else can I do?
